Skip to content
Red Lobster (6230 Grand Ave.)

Red Lobster (6230 Grand Ave.)

4.3 xStar (600+)10094 kmSeafoodAmericanFamily MealsFamily FriendlyGroup Friendly¥¥Info

xDelivery bag remove Delivery unavailable

6230 Grand Ave